CN-224227962-U - Assembled prefabricated component balcony
Abstract
The utility model provides an assembled prefabricated component balcony, which comprises a balcony top suspension assembly and a balcony suspension assembly, wherein the balcony top suspension assembly is arranged right above the balcony suspension assembly, the balcony top suspension assembly and the balcony suspension assembly are connected with a building main body through expansion bolts, the building main body comprises vertical connecting columns and horizontal connecting floors, the vertical connecting columns arranged left and right are connected with a balcony top plate in the balcony top suspension assembly through anchor cables, the horizontal connecting floors are connected with a balcony fixing bottom plate in the balcony suspension assembly through anchor cables, the anchor cables are fixedly suspended on the outermost edges of the balcony top plate and the balcony fixing bottom plate, and the vertical connecting columns are arranged on the left side surface and the right side surface of the horizontal connecting floors. The assembled prefabricated component balcony greatly shortens the construction time, improves the construction efficiency, reduces the pollution of noise, dust and the like on site, and reduces the interference to the life and the environment of surrounding residents.

Assembled prefabricated component balcony Technical Field The utility model belongs to the technical field of prefabricated parts, and particularly relates to an assembled prefabricated part balcony. Background The traditional balcony construction mode is generally cast and built on site, and the mode has the problems of long construction period, low efficiency, difficult quality assurance and the like. The assembled prefabricated part balcony is used as an important component of the assembled building, and the connection mode of the assembled prefabricated part balcony and the main body structure directly influences the structural safety and the usability of the balcony. At present, the traditional balcony structure is not stable enough with the connected mode of building main part, in long-term use, receives external factor's influence easily, like wind-force, earthquake etc. leads to the balcony structure to appear cracking, warp even collapse's danger, and in addition, traditional balcony structure often lacks the flexibility in design and construction, can not adapt to the demand and the complex building environment of different buildings well. Disclosure of utility model In view of this, the present utility model aims to provide an assembled prefabricated member balcony, which solves the problems that the connection mode between the traditional balcony structure and the main building body is not stable enough, and the balcony structure is easily affected by external factors, such as wind power, earthquake, etc., so that the balcony structure is cracked, deformed, or even collapsed in the long-term use process, and in addition, the traditional balcony structure often lacks flexibility in design and construction, and cannot well adapt to the requirements of different buildings and complex building environments.
